When it comes to 3D printing, the nozzle material plays a crucial role in print quality, durability, and compatibility with different filaments.
Here’s a quick breakdown of the most common nozzle types that we stock at DREMC so you know which nozzle you purchase would be best suited for your use case :
1. Brass Nozzles
✅ Best for standard filaments like PLA, ABS, and PETG
✅ Low cost, high thermal conductivity
❌ Wears out quickly with any abrasive filaments (e.g., carbon/glass fiber, glow-in-the-dark) due to softer metal or overtime.

2. Plated Copper Nozzles / Plated Brass Nozzle
✅ Higher heat transfer for faster, more consistent extrusion
✅ Corrosion-resistant coating for extended lifespan
❌ Not as hard as steel, so it still wears with abrasives material but better wear resistant compare to brass

3. Hardened Steel Nozzles
✅ Excellent for abrasive filaments like carbon fiber and glass-filled materials
✅ Much more durable than brass or copper and most cost effective for abrasive materials
❌ Lower heat transfer, so requires higher temperatures

4. Hardened Steel Tip + Copper Nozzles
✅ Best of both worlds—high heat transfer from copper, durability from steel
✅ Great for both standard and abrasive filaments
❌ 2 part nozzle assembly, cold pull and force push is not recommended when clearing partial clogging, to reduce the chance of insert coming loose.

5. Full Tungsten Nozzles
✅ Extremely wear-resistant and maintains precision over time
✅ High thermal conductivity compare to hardened steel
❌ Lower thermal conductivity compare to hardened steel tip and copper options

6. Diamond Tip Nozzles
✅ Ultra-durable with highest wear resistance
✅ High thermal conductivity compare due to two part nozzle using brass/coppper for higher thermal conductivity.
❌ 2 part nozzle assembly, cold pull and force push is not recommended when clearing partial clogging, to reduce the chance of insert coming loose and the cost.

Which Nozzle Should You Choose?
- For standard printing → Plated Copper
- On a budget and no abrasive use → Brass Nozzle
- For frequent abrasive use → Hardened Steel Tip + Copper
- For high-end, long-term durability → Tungsten or Diamond Tip
